Output 1644c50516aaf563ddd3796297c695646848f9d7488ceb0f040c576c89359256:1

value
43519862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669f64ae29a6c29d225cbcb7390b25cb9bdd0fcb OP_EQUAL
address
3B3dnx3ekAhYwVQ9nvUG5TULNGka811xJJ
transaction
1644c50516aaf563ddd3796297c695646848f9d7488ceb0f040c576c89359256
spent
true